2004 Ford Focus vs. 2012 Honda Odyssey

To start off, 2012 Honda Odyssey is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Ford Focus.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Ford Focus would be higher. At 3,500 cc (6 cylinders), 2012 Honda Odyssey is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2012 Honda Odyssey (248 HP @ 5700 RPM) has 104 more horse power than 2004 Ford Focus. (144 HP @ 6250 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2012 Honda Odyssey should accelerate faster than 2004 Ford Focus.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2012 Honda Odyssey weights approximately 819 kg more than 2004 Ford Focus.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2012 Honda Odyssey (339 Nm) has 137 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Ford Focus. (202 Nm). This means 2012 Honda Odyssey will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Ford Focus.

Compare all specifications:

2004 Ford Focus 2012 Honda Odyssey
Make Ford Honda
Model Focus Odyssey
Year Released 2004 2012
Body Type Sedan Minivan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2260 cc 3500 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 144 HP 248 HP
Engine RPM 6250 RPM 5700 RPM
Torque 202 Nm 339 Nm
Drive Type Front Front
Number of Seats 5 seats 7 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1182 kg 2001 kg
Vehicle Length 4280 mm 5154 mm
Vehicle Width 1710 mm 2012 mm
Vehicle Height 1440 mm 1737 mm
Wheelbase Size 2620 mm 3000 mm
Fuel Consumption 7.1 L/100km 8.7 L/100km
Fuel Consumption City 9.4 L/100km 13.1 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 53 L 79 L
